It was discovered that the computeNextExponential() method in the Libraries component of OpenJDK failed to comply with the documentation, returning sometimes negative numbers.

CVE-2022-21549 is a vulnerability in the Oracle Java SE and Oracle GraalVM Enterprise Edition products that allows unauthenticated attackers to exploit the system.
Oracle Java SE versions 17.0.3.1, 17.0.6+10-1~deb11u1, and 17.0.6+10-1, as well as Oracle GraalVM Enterprise Edition versions 21.3.2 and 22.1.0, are affected by CVE-2022-21549.
CVE-2022-21549 can be easily exploited by unauthenticated attackers.
